生物医用T42NG铁合金腐蚀性能研究
Research on the Corrosion of T42NG Titanium Alloys Applied to Biomedicine
【摘要】 对生物医用的T42NG经3Cr13不锈钢复合构成的T42NG钛合金"双金属材料",在常温常常压下3 5%的NaCl水溶液中,采用"三电极体系"实验装置运用恒电位法测定其阳极稳态极化曲线,对其电化学腐蚀行为进行了系统地研究。结果表明:经3Cr13不锈钢复合后的T42NG钛合金,其电极过程的阳极稳态极化曲线几乎只有纯化区和析氧区,不易发生腐蚀。
【Abstract】 Using a lab constant potential method to determine anodic stead polarization curves,the authors systematically studied electrochemical corrosion reaction of titanium alloys applied to biomedicine,such as T42NG titanium alloys bimetals,which were compounded by 3Cr13 stainless steels,at normal room temperature and air pressure,in the 3.5% NaCl water solution.The results obtained showed that in the process of electrode,the anodic steady polarization of T742 NG titanium alloys bimetals compounded by curves almost had only passivation regions and oxygen evolution regions and stable passivation potential regions,and this kind of compounded titanium alloys bimetals could not be destroyed easity.
【Key words】 biomedical T42NG titanium; electrochemical corrosion; anodic steady polarization curve; passivation;
